We are seeking a tech-savvy professional looking for a career within the legal system to join our team as an independently contracted Digital Reporter. In this role, you will officiate legal proceedings using high-quality digital audio equipment to capture the verbatim record of a deposition or other legal proceedings. Digital Reporters (DR)’s are not shorthand reporters or stenographers, and no stenographic tools or training is required.
Responsibilities
- Managing legal proceedings as an independent arbiter of the record
- Generating clear and complete recordings of the proceeding using high-fidelity audio technology
- Creating accurate and detailed annotations of case events and terminology to augment recorded information for transcription.
